Rangers arrive with the stronger recent scoring record, but both sides have been involved in high-event games and that points towards chances at either end. Falkirk have scored in four of their last five league matches, while Rangers have also been in matches with plenty of goals, including the 6-3 win over Falkirk in April. With no xG data available, the clearest guide is the recent results, and those suggest Rangers have enough attacking edge to edge a close contest.

Falkirk’s home results show they can compete, but they have also conceded three or more in three of their last five league games. Rangers have lost three straight league matches, so there is some vulnerability there, yet their earlier win over Falkirk and the overall head-to-head pattern still lean their way. Form Guide & Team Overview

Falkirk

Falkirk’s recent league form has been mixed, with two wins and three defeats in their last five. They beat Motherwell 1-0 at home and 3-2 away, but they also lost 1-3 to Hibernian at home, 1-3 to Celtic away and 3-6 to Rangers at home.

The main pattern is that Falkirk have been able to score, but they have struggled to keep games tight at the back. Four of those five league matches saw them concede at least one goal, and three of them saw them concede three or more.

Rangers

Rangers come into this on the back of three straight league defeats, losing 1-3 to Celtic away, 1-2 to Hearts away and 2-3 to Motherwell at home. Before that run, they did beat Falkirk 6-3 away and Dundee United 4-2 at home, so their recent results have been more open than controlled.

That sequence suggests Rangers are still creating enough to score, but they have not been able to turn that into points in the last three league games. The goals against have also been a factor, with each of those defeats seeing them concede at least two.
